The Psychological Factors at Play
The psychological aspects of gambling play a tremendous role in shaping a player’s journey along the chicken road. As one progresses, emotions such as excitement, fear, and hope can impact decision-making processes. Recognizing these emotional triggers is vital for maintaining a level-headed approach.
Many players experience a phenomenon known as the “gambler’s fallacy,” where they believe past outcomes will influence future results. For instance, if a particular number hasn’t appeared in roulette, players may think it is ‘due’ to hit soon. Understanding the random nature of such games is crucial to avoid making irrational decisions based on emotions rather than logic.

Setting Limits
Establishing limits is fundamental for maintaining control while traversing the chicken road. Players should define their maximum spending and loss limits before beginning a gaming session. This approach facilitates more mindful gambling and reduces the risk of impromptu decisions that can lead to tragic financial consequences.
Consider the following when setting your limits:
- Daily Limits: Determine a spending limit for each gaming session.
- Win Limits: Decide on winning goals that trigger your departure from the game.
- Loss Limits: Assess how much you are willing to lose before quitting.
- Time Limits: Allocate a specific duration for your gaming session to enhance control.

The Role of House Edge
Understanding the house edge is a critical component of successful gambling. The house always retains a mathematical advantage, which can fluctuate across various games. Knowledge of the house edge empowers players to make informed decisions, leading to better long-term outcomes when traversing the chicken road.
When selecting a game or placing bets, familiarizing oneself with the house edge can provide insights into the likelihood of winning. Lower house edges generally offer better returns for players, encouraging a more strategic approach while navigating the casino landscape.
